W&L Defeats H-SC for ODAC Title

Win Marks 28th Overall Men's Tennis Crown

LEXINGTON, Va. --- The 16th-ranked Washington and Lee men's tennis team defeated Hampden-Sydney, 9-0, to claim its 13th-straight ODAC championship. The Generals will receive the conference's automatic bid to the NCAA Tournament.

#16 Washington and Lee 9, Hampden-Sydney 0
at Lexington, Va.

Singles Competition

1. Nat Estes (W&L) def. Rich Pugh (HSC) 6-1, 6-1
2. Tim Ross (W&L) def. Shad Harrell (HSC) 6-3, 6-2
3. Brent Meyers (W&L) def. Zack Pack (HSC) 6-0, 6-0
4. Jamie McCardell (W&L) def. Tal Covington (HSC) 6-3, 6-4
5. Stuart Sanford (W&L) def. Andrew McLeod (HSC) 6-0, 6-0
6. Morgan Hopson (W&L) def. Kenneth Holzapfel (HSC) 6-2, 6-3

Doubles Competition
1. T. Ross/J. McCardell (W&L) def. R. Pugh/K. Holzapfel (HSC) 8-0
2. N. Estes/M. Hopson (W&L) def. S. Harrell/Z. Pack (HSC) 8-1
3. S. Sanford/A. Brooke (W&L) def. T. Covington/A. McLeod (HSC) 8-0
